Ingredients for Creamy Parmesan Cajun Chicken Pasta Soup
Essential ingredients you’ll need
To whip up a delicious and hearty Creamy Parmesan Cajun Chicken Pasta Soup, gather the following essential ingredients:
- 1 tablespoon oil
- 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s
- 1 teaspoon cajun seasoning
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 1 cup onion, diced
- 1 cup celery, diced
- 1 cup bell pepper, diced
- 4 cloves garlic, chopped
- 1 teaspoon thyme, chopped
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 1 (14.5 ounce) can diced tomatoes (optional)
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ce (opt for gluten-free if needed)
- 8 ounces of pasta (like ditalini or shells; gluten-free if necessary)
- ½ cup heavy cream (optional)
- ⅓ cup Parmigiano Reggiano (or Parmesan cheese), grated
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ice (optional)
- 2 tablespoons parsley, chopped (optional)
- 2 green onions, thinly sliced (optional)
- Cayenne, salt, and pepper to taste

Cook the chicken to perfection
Heat the oil in a spacious saucepan over medium-high heat. Season the chicken with the Cajun seasoning and cook for about 2-4 minutes on each side until it’s golden brown. Remember, you’re not cooking it through yet—you just want that lovely sear! Once done, set the chicken aside for later.
Sauté the vegetables and spices
In the same pan, melt the butter. Add in the diced onion, celery, and bell pepper, cooking for about 5-7 minutes until the veggies become tender. The aroma in your kitchen at this point is likely divine! Then, add the garlic, thyme, and an additional tablespoon of Cajun seasoning, stirring for about a minute to release those robust flavors.
Combine broth and pasta for that creamy base
Now it’s time to add the liquids. Pour in the chicken broth, and if you choose, the diced tomatoes and Worcestershire sauce. This is where the magic happens! Bring everything to a boil before adding in the pasta. Allow the mixture to simmer for about 7 minutes, or until the pasta is al dente. You’ll want to keep stirring to ensure the flavors meld properly.
Return the chicken and finish with cream and parmesan
Once the pasta is almost ready, slice or shred the chicken and return it to the pot. Turn off the heat, and then stir in the heavy cream and grated parmesan. Allow the cheese to melt into the broth for that dreamy, creamy consistency. If you like, finish your Creamy Parmesan Cajun Chicken Pasta Soup with a squeeze of lemon juice, fresh parsley, and green onions for a pop of color and flavor.

FAQs about Creamy Parmesan Cajun Chicken Pasta Soup
Can I make this soup in a slow cooker?
Absolutely! To make your creamy parmesan cajun chicken pasta soup in a slow cooker, start by searing the chicken and sautéing the veggies (steps 1-3). Then, transfer everything except the pasta into the slow cooker and cook on LOW for 6-10 hours or HIGH for 2-4 hours. Just add the pasta during the last 10 minutes of cooking so it doesn’t get too mushy.
What if I don’t have chicken broth?
If chicken broth isn’t handy, don’t fret! You can substitute with low-sodium vegetable broth or even homemade broth. Alternatively, water with a few bouillon cubes can do the trick. This keeps the flavor vibrant while accommodating what you have on hand!
How can I make it gluten-free?
Going gluten-free is simple! Just use gluten-free pasta and ensure your Worcestershire sauce is gluten-free as well. There are plenty of gluten-free pasta options nowadays, like chickpea or brown rice pasta, available at most grocery stores.

Creamy Parmesan Cajun Chicken Pasta Soup
Equipment
- large saucepan
Ingredients
Pasta Soup Ingredients
- 1 tablespoon oil
- 1 pound boneless and skinless chicken breasts or thighs
- 1 teaspoon cajun seasoning
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 1 cup onion, diced
- 1 cup celery, diced
- 1 cup bell pepper, diced
- 4 cloves garlic, chopped
- 1 teaspoon thyme, chopped
- 1 tablespoon cajun seasoning
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 1 14.5 ounce can diced tomatoes optional
- 1 tablespoon worcestershire sauce gluten-free for gluten-free
- 8 ounces pasta such as ditalini or shells (gluten-free for gluten-free)
- ½ cup heavy/whipping cream optional
- ⅓ cup parmigiano reggiano (parmesan cheese), grated
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ice optional
- 2 tablespoons parsley, chopped optional
- 2 green onions thinly sliced optional
- cayenne to taste
- salt to taste
- pepper to taste
Instructions
Cooking Instructions
- Heat the oil in a large saucepan over medium-high heat, add the chicken, seasoned with the cajun seasoning, and cook until golden brown, about 2-4 minutes per side, before setting aside.
- Melt the butter in the same saucepan before adding the onion, celery, and bell pepper and cooking until tender, about 5-7 minutes.
- Add the garlic, thyme, and cajun seasoning, and cook until fragrant, about a minute.
- Add the broth, chicken, diced tomatoes, worcestershire sauce, and pasta, bring to a boil, reduce the heat and simmer until the pasta is al-dente tender, about 7 minutes.
- Remove the chicken, slice or shred it, and return it to the pot.
- Turn off the heat, add the cream and parmesan, mix and let the cheese melt into the broth.
- Add the lemon juice, parsley, and green onions, and season with cayenne, salt, and pepper to taste before enjoying!
